TriSalus Life Sciences Reports 53% Revenue Growth in 2025, Reaffirms 2026 Guidance

  • TriSalus Life Sciences reported $45.2 million in revenue for 2025, a 53% increase year-over-year, driven by TriNav system sales.
  • Fourth-quarter 2025 net sales were $13.2 million, a 60% year-over-year increase.
  • The company raised $46 million in a public offering to support growth initiatives.
  • 2026 revenue guidance reaffirmed at $60 million to $62 million.
  • Gross margin improved to 86.7% in Q4 2025, up from 85.3% in Q4 2024.

TriSalus Life Sciences is capitalizing on the growing adoption of its TriNav product suite and PEDD platform across solid tumor indications. The company's strategic focus on expanding into new clinical settings and enhancing its embolization toolkit positions it to compete in the evolving interventional radiology market. With $46 million in fresh capital, TriSalus aims to accelerate its commercial and clinical initiatives, potentially broadening its addressable market.
